  • Aftermarket intake question

    Hello

    I'm presently adding a new head on my XP787 to raise compression.

    Also the other modification is I'm planning to buy an aftermarket intake for my XP787, my question is, does the aftermarket intake will realy change something , cause i still got the stock carb for now.

    I mean does it worth it. may be you got one, i would appreciate your advise since you put it on ski

    Thank you

    Re: Aftermarket intake question

    depends on the intake. You should add flame arrestors, re-jet the carbs and buy a Solas XO prop...

    That will give you the best bang for the buck.

    Also remember, most, if not all A/M intakes will force you to go premix.

      Re: Aftermarket intake question

      On a 787 you do not need a new intake unless you get aftermarket carbs. If you get spigot mounts get a r/d direct flow. Beware with the r/d that over the years the casting has shifted and you will need to line things up with the case to be perfect.

      If you get flange mount, I think you are just as good hogging out the stock manifold to match your carb......
